Opportunity
New digital and digital health-based medical technologies hold the promise of developing more efficient models of care and innovative ways to develop and adopt new medicines and treatments across the health sector.
A lack of a digital-ready healthcare workforce limits the ability to adopt and integrate new digital health technology advances into the workplace and everyday practices. This is preventing health systems from realising the health, economic, and social benefits these technologies have to society. There are many capability frameworks, but no clear guidance on how healthcare providers should operationalise these products. Committed to empowering the health workforce with advanced competencies in digital health and artificial intelligence, this project will form a consortium across the Queensland public health system to identify and bridge the skill gaps to support digital workforce capability in Queensland. This project is a government – academic – industry strategic partnership that aims to create a robust, forward-thinking workforce that can drive healthcare transformation and improve patient outcomes.
Project Objectives
- Establish the EMBRACE consortium, comprised of government, industry and academia, towards the strategic and effective bridging of the skill gaps in digital health workforce capability in Queensland.
- Conduct a learning needs assessment to understand the critical gaps in digital capability and develop a roadmap with recommendations and strategies to address these.
- Design and develop a comprehensive curriculum and education and training program relevant to various roles in Queensland Health.
